Factors Affecting Cost
Slate roof construction in Cheshire County, NH, involves selecting durable materials and understanding the scope of work required. This overview provides an outline of typical considerations, including materials used, project size, labor complexity, permitting requirements, and additional options to enhance the roof's functionality or appearance.
- Materials: Natural slate tiles or synthetic slate options are common, offering longevity and aesthetic appeal suitable for historic and modern structures in Cheshire County.
- Size and Scope: Projects can range from small residential replacements to extensive roof coverings on larger buildings, depending on the property size and design preferences.
- Labor Complexity: Installation requires specialized craftsmanship due to the weight and precise placement of slate tiles, often involving additional structural considerations.
- Permitting: Local building codes in Cheshire County typically require permits for roofing projects, especially those involving significant structural modifications or historic preservation standards.
- Extras: Optional features include integrated drainage systems, decorative slates, or weatherproofing enhancements to extend roof lifespan and performance.
